Beschreibung
Für unseren Kunden, eine Verwertungsgesellschaft, suchen wir einen Java Entwickler (w/m/d) zur Unterstützung im Projekt.
Aufgaben- Die Anwendung soll aus mehreren MicroServices erstellt werden und auf einem Kubernetes Cluster laufen, das Backend basiert auf Spring-Boot
- Das Deployment erfolgt über eine Jenkins Pipeline; SonarQube wird unter anderem zur Qualitätssicherung verwendet
- Der Reklamationsservice wird Prozess gesteuert (nicht Ereignis-gesteuert), also orchestriert
- Vor diesem Hintergrund ist die Aufteilung der Anwendung Reklamationsservice in mehrere Microservices bisher grob geplant und nun detailliert weiter zu entwickeln
- Die Anwendung wird cloud-nativ unter Anwendung der Grundsätze von CI/CD in der Google Cloud aufgebaut, um nach Ende des Projekts im Sinne von DevOps weiter entwickelt bzw. betrieben zu werden
- Sehr gute Kenntnisse in Java speziell in MicroServices
- Kenntnisse in Kubernetes
- Know-how in Camunda, CI/CD sowie Jenkins, IntelliJ
- Verständnis in DevOps, Angular sowie in REST-Schnittstellen
- Wünschenswert wäre Wissen in Google Cloud (GCP)
https://www.etengo.de/it-projektsuche/83371/